Roof Exhaust Installation in Cabin John, MD
Roof exhaust installation services involve adding or upgrading vents on a home's roof to improve airflow and ventilation within the building. These projects typically include installing attic vents, exhaust fans, or ridge vents to help regulate temperature, reduce moisture buildup, and prevent issues like mold or ice dam formation. Homeowners often request this service when experiencing excessive heat in the attic, persistent humidity, or signs of poor ventilation, aiming to enhance energy efficiency and indoor air quality.
Before requesting roof exhaust installation, property owners usually want to understand the types of vents suitable for their roof structure, the impact on overall home comfort, and any necessary preparations or considerations. It is also common to inquire about how the new exhaust systems will integrate with existing roofing materials and whether additional modifications are needed to ensure proper function. Clear information about the scope of work and expected benefits can help homeowners make informed decisions about their ventilation needs.

Roof Exhaust Installation Questions
What is roof exhaust installation? It involves adding vents or fans to the roof to improve airflow and ventilation inside the building.
Why should property owners consider roof exhaust systems? They help reduce moisture buildup, improve air quality, and prevent mold growth in the attic or roof space.
What types of roof exhaust options are available? Common options include ridge vents, soffit vents, and powered attic fans, each suited to different ventilation needs.
When is roof exhaust installation typically needed? It is often recommended during roof replacements or when signs of poor ventilation, such as excess heat or moisture, are observed.
